Step-by-step in your kitchen
Step 1
Choose your pairing
Works with idli, dosa, uttapam, curd rice, or even as a sprinkle on warm chapati.
Step 2
Layer on ghee or oil
For idli-dosa, spread a thin smear of ghee or sesame oil so the powder sticks and the flavour opens up.
Step 3
Sprinkle and press
Add a spoon of Ojas Chutney Pudi and press gently with the back of the spoon for even coverage.
Step 4
Optional crunch toast
For extra aroma, warm the powder in dry pan 10 seconds before serving — watch heat so peanuts do not scorch.
